With comprehensive coverage, windshield repair and replacement are typically covered in Vermont. Many policies waive the deductible for chip repairs, and shops bill your insurer directly — so you may pay little to nothing out of pocket.
Yes. Most Vermont auto glass shops offer free mobile service, sending a technician to your home, office, or roadside location for both quick repairs and full windshield replacements.
Expect roughly $250–$450 for a standard Vermont windshield, or $600–$1,000 for newer vehicles that require ADAS camera recalibration. Chip repairs usually run $60–$150 and are frequently free with comprehensive insurance.
